The Rise of Piezo Inkjet Printing

Piezo inkjet printing has gained significant popularity in recent years due to its numerous advantages over traditional printing methods. Unlike continuous inkjet printing, which relies on pressure-based mechanisms, piezo inkjet utilizes an advanced piezoelectric crystal to control ink droplet formation.

One of the main advantages of piezo inkjet is its ability to print on a variety of substrates, including both porous and non-porous surfaces. This makes it ideal for a wide range of applications, from packaging to industrial coding. Additionally, piezo inkjet printers offer greater precision and accuracy, delivering high-resolution prints with precise droplet placement.

Understanding Continuous Inkjet Printing

Continuous inkjet printing, on the other hand, has been a popular choice for industrial coding applications for several decades. This printing technology operates by generating a continuous stream of ink droplets, with the unwanted ones redirected back into the system. The desired ink droplets are then electrostatically deflected onto the printing substrate, creating the desired image or code.

Continuous inkjet printers are known for their high-speed operation, making them suitable for applications that require quick and efficient coding. They are also capable of printing on a wide range of surfaces, including uneven or curved ones.
